-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
张颖超微机原理课件
XX有限公司
汇报人:XX
目录
第一章
微机原理基础
第二章
指令系统与汇编语言
第四章
微机系统设计
第三章
输入输出系统
第六章
微机原理教学方法
第五章
微机原理应用实例
微机原理基础
第一章
微机系统概述
微处理器是微机系统的核心,负责执行指令和处理数据,如Intel的x86架构。
微处理器的角色
存储器分为RAM和ROM,RAM用于临时存储运行数据,ROM存储固件和启动程序。
存储器的分类
输入输出系统负责微机与外部设备的数据交换,例如键盘、鼠标和显示器。
输入输出系统
总线是连接微处理器、存储器和输入输出设备的通信路径,如PCI总线。
总线结构
微处理器架构
CPU是微处理器的核心,负责执行指令和处理数据,如Intel的x86架构和ARM处理器。
中央处理单元(CPU)
微处理器中包含不同类型的存储器,如寄存器、高速缓存(Cache)、主存,以优化性能。
存储器层次结构
I/O系统负责微处理器与外部设备的数据交换,如USB接口和PCI总线。
输入输出(I/O)系统
ISA定义了微处理器能理解和执行的指令集,如x86指令集和MIPS架构。
指令集架构(ISA)
存储器分类与功能
RAM允许数据的读写操作,是计算机运行时存储临时数据的关键部件,如DDR4内存条。
随机存取存储器(RAM)
Cache位于CPU和主存之间,用于临时存储频繁访问的数据,以减少处理器的等待时间,如L1、L2Cache。
高速缓存(Cache)
ROM存储的数据在断电后不会丢失,常用于存储固件和启动程序,如BIOS芯片。
只读存储器(ROM)
01
02
03
存储器分类与功能
SSD使用闪存技术,提供快速的数据读写速度,是现代计算机中常见的存储设备,如NVMeSSD。
固态硬盘(SSD)
磁盘存储设备如硬盘驱动器(HDD),用于长期存储大量数据,通过磁性记录信息,如传统的机械硬盘。
磁盘存储
指令系统与汇编语言
第二章
指令集架构
指令集架构是计算机硬件与软件之间的接口,定义了处理器能执行的指令类型和格式。
01
指令集架构的定义
例如x86架构、ARM架构等,它们决定了处理器的性能和适用范围。
02
常见的指令集架构
不同的指令集架构要求微处理器有不同的设计,影响着处理器的复杂度和效率。
03
指令集与微处理器设计
汇编语言基础
01
汇编语言是一种低级编程语言,它与机器语言紧密相关,但使用助记符代替二进制代码。
02
每条汇编指令通常由操作码(指令功能)和操作数(指令作用对象)组成,用于直接控制硬件。
03
汇编语言使用符号来表示内存地址、寄存器和常数,简化了编程过程,提高了代码的可读性。
04
汇编语言与特定的处理器架构紧密相关,不同的处理器架构有不同的汇编指令集。
05
汇编语言常用于嵌入式系统、操作系统开发和性能敏感型应用中,因其执行效率高。
汇编语言的定义
汇编指令的组成
汇编语言的符号
汇编语言与硬件的关系
汇编语言的应用场景
指令执行过程
CPU从内存中读取指令,通过程序计数器(PC)指向的地址获取下一条要执行的指令。
指令的获取
01
获取指令后,CPU的控制单元对指令进行解码,确定需要执行的操作类型和操作数。
指令的解码
02
解码完成后,CPU根据指令内容,通过算术逻辑单元(ALU)执行相应的运算或数据处理。
指令的执行
03
执行完毕后,结果会被存储回内存或寄存器中,为下一条指令的执行做准备。
结果的存储
04
输入输出系统
第三章
输入输出接口
01
并行接口
并行接口允许数据同时通过多个通道传输,提高数据传输速率,常用于打印机和外部存储设备。
02
串行接口
串行接口一次只传输一位数据,虽然速度较慢,但连接简单,成本低,适用于鼠标和键盘等设备。
03
USB接口
USB接口支持热插拔,即插即用,广泛应用于各种计算机外设,如U盘、移动硬盘等。
04
HDMI接口
HDMI接口能够传输未压缩的视频数据和压缩或未压缩的音频数据,常用于连接显示器和电视机。
中断系统原理
中断请求与响应
微处理器在执行程序时,通过中断请求信号暂停当前任务,响应外部或内部的紧急事件。
中断屏蔽与嵌套
中断屏蔽用于暂时忽略某些中断请求,而中断嵌套允许高优先级中断打断正在处理的低优先级中断。
中断优先级
中断向量表
中断系统根据优先级决定处理中断的顺序,高优先级中断可打断低优先级中断的处理。
中断向量表存储中断服务程序的入口地址,CPU根据中断号查找对应的服务程序进行处理。
直接存储器访问(DMA)
01
DMA允许外设直接访问内存,无需CPU介入,提高数据传输效率。
DMA的基本概念
02
DMA控制器接管总线,直接在内存和I/O设备间传输数据,减少CPU负担。
DMA的工作原理
03
在DMA传输期间,CPU可以执行
您可能关注的文档
最近下载
- 2023-2024学年辽宁省大连市沙河口区八年级(上)期末数学试卷+答案解析.pdf VIP
- 统编版(2024)七年级下册道德与法治11.1《法不可违》教案 .pdf VIP
- 小学生古诗词大赛试题(附答案).docx VIP
- GPIR复合外模板现浇混凝土保温系统建筑构造.pdf VIP
- 中小学校长选拔笔试试题及参考答案.docx VIP
- 全国计算机等级考试教程二级WPS Office高级应用与设计:电子表格的创建与编辑PPT教学课件.pptx VIP
- 黔西南州企业融资难融资贵主要情况反馈.doc VIP
- 垂径定理练习.3 垂径定理练习.doc VIP
- (已压缩)关于建筑设计防火的原则规定(1960)(OCR).pdf VIP
- 工业与民用建筑抗震设计规范TJ11-78.pdf VIP
文档评论(0)